Monett waltzed into their match on Monday with five straight wins... but they left with six. They were the clear victors by a 3-0 margin over the Forsyth Panthers. The Cubs have seen this before: they got the W the last time they saw the Panthers, too.
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-10, 25-21, 25-15.
Monett got their win on the backs of several key players, but it was Kylee Holloway out in front who had five digs and three aces. That's the most aces Holloway has posted over her last 13 matchups.
Holloway wasn't the only good servers: Monett was lethal from the service line and finished the match with 16 aces.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now served at least five aces in four consecutive contests.
Monett's victory bumped their record up to 15-5-2. As for Forsyth, their defeat was their sixth straight on the road d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 2-12-2.
Monett did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next match, a 3-0 win against Cassville on the 30th. As for Forsyth, they have also already played their next matchup, a 3-0 loss against Clever on the 30th.
